Membership Spotlight: Tree House


COLDWATER — Meet two of our latest members. The owners of The Tree House Provision Center, Courtney Sekela and Amanda Wills, are poised to be the first to obtain the permits
and licenses needed to open their Adult Use Recreational Facility here in
the city of Coldwater. It has been almost three years since Michigan voters
overwhelmingly approved the legalization of adult-use recreational
Marijuana, but the Coldwater City Council only began issuing permits for
Marijuana storefronts late last year. “To our knowledge, we’re the only
local businesspeople to obtain any of the recreational permits that have
been granted by the City,” said Courtney Sekela, co-creator. “We’ve been
growing our business in Coldwater for years now. Our families live here,
our children go to school here, and our customers seek us out for an
experience they can’t get from anyone else.”
“We have been working to achieve this goal for 7 years, and we couldn’t be
happier to see it finally come to fruition.” said The Tree House’s co-creator
Amanda Wills. “From the beginning it’s just been [my business partner]
Courtney and me; we don’t have any big investors. We’re really proud to be
leading the way in introducing a new industry to Coldwater.” At their May
3 meeting, the Coldwater Planning Commission recommended announcing
a 90-day moratorium on further Marijuana Licensing application due to
the overwhelming business interest in opening new Production and Retail
operations.
Sekela and Wills are no strangers to creating interesting retail
destinations. The pair already operate The Tree House Garden Center in
Coldwater, which recently relocated to a revamped location in Downtown
Coldwater, now open at 34 E Chicago St. They also own The Nest in
Camden, MI, a medical and recreational Provisioning Center. The Tree
House Provision Center can be found on the web at
www.mastersofthetreehouse.com, and will be open for business 9am-9pm
7 days a week at their location in the woods at 894 E. Chicago St. in
Coldwater.
